数据库映射端口是什么

worktile 其他 22

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库映射端口是指用于在计算机网络中将数据库服务器和客户端之间进行通信的特定端口。数据库服务器使用该端口来监听客户端的连接请求,并将数据库的查询结果返回给客户端。

    以下是关于数据库映射端口的五个重要点:

    1. 默认端口:不同的数据库管理系统(DBMS)使用不同的默认端口。例如,MySQL的默认端口是3306,Oracle的默认端口是1521,SQL Server的默认端口是1433。在安装和配置数据库时,通常会将这些默认端口用于数据库的映射。

    2. 网络安全:数据库映射端口对于网络安全非常重要。如果数据库的映射端口对外开放,未经授权的用户可能会尝试通过该端口进行未经授权的访问和攻击。因此,为了保护数据库的安全,通常会采取一些安全措施,如使用防火墙、访问控制列表(ACL)等来限制对数据库映射端口的访问。

    3. 端口冲突:在同一台计算机上运行多个数据库服务器时,可能会出现端口冲突的情况。这意味着两个或多个数据库服务器试图使用相同的端口进行通信,从而导致冲突。为了解决这个问题,可以手动更改数据库的映射端口,确保它们在同一台计算机上唯一。

    4. 端口转发:有时,数据库服务器位于内部网络中,而客户端位于外部网络中。在这种情况下,可以使用端口转发来实现客户端与数据库服务器之间的通信。端口转发是一种将外部网络的请求转发到内部网络的技术,它可以通过将外部网络的请求发送到数据库服务器所在的内部网络上的一台计算机上,然后再将查询结果返回给客户端。

    5. 端口扫描:黑客和恶意用户经常使用端口扫描工具来探测网络上的开放端口。他们可以使用这些开放端口进行非法访问、攻击或渗透。因此,为了保护数据库的安全,管理员应该定期进行端口扫描,并确保只有必要的端口对外开放,同时采取安全措施来防止未经授权的访问和攻击。

    总结来说,数据库映射端口是用于数据库服务器和客户端之间进行通信的特定端口。了解数据库映射端口的重要性和安全性对于保护数据库的安全和性能至关重要。管理员应该熟悉数据库的默认端口、网络安全措施、端口冲突解决方案、端口转发技术和端口扫描工具,以确保数据库的安全和可靠性。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库映射端口是指在计算机网络中,用于连接和交互数据库的特定端口号。数据库系统使用端口号来标识和区分不同的服务。通过指定特定的端口号,客户端应用程序可以与数据库服务器建立连接,并进行数据的读取、写入和查询等操作。

    常见的数据库映射端口包括:

    1. MySQL:默认端口号为3306,可以通过修改配置文件my.cnf来更改端口号。

    2. Oracle:默认端口号为1521,可以通过修改listener.ora文件来更改端口号。

    3. SQL Server:默认端口号为1433,可以通过SQL Server配置管理器来更改端口号。

    4. PostgreSQL:默认端口号为5432,可以通过修改postgresql.conf文件来更改端口号。

    5. MongoDB:默认端口号为27017,可以通过修改配置文件mongod.conf来更改端口号。

    在使用数据库时,客户端应用程序需要使用相应的数据库连接字符串来指定数据库服务器的IP地址和端口号。通过连接字符串,客户端应用程序可以与数据库服务器建立连接,并进行数据的传输和交互。

    需要注意的是,数据库映射端口一般需要在防火墙中打开相应的入站规则,以允许外部网络与数据库服务器进行通信。同时,为了保障数据库的安全性,需要设置强密码和限制访问权限,避免未授权的访问和攻击。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库映射端口是指用于将数据库服务暴露给外部应用程序或网络的端口号。通过映射端口,可以实现远程访问数据库,使得多台计算机或不同网络中的应用程序可以访问和操作数据库。

    在数据库中,每个服务都需要使用一个端口号来与外界进行通信。常见的数据库服务如MySQL、Oracle、SQL Server等都有默认的端口号。例如,MySQL的默认端口号是3306,Oracle的默认端口号是1521。

    数据库映射端口的设置和使用可以通过以下步骤完成:

    1. 确定数据库服务所使用的默认端口号:不同的数据库服务有不同的默认端口号,可以在数据库的官方文档或配置文件中查找。例如,MySQL的默认端口号是3306。

    2. 确定数据库所在的计算机或服务器的IP地址:IP地址是用于标识网络中计算机或服务器的唯一标识符,可以通过运行命令 ipconfig(Windows)或 ifconfig(Linux)来查找。

    3. 配置数据库服务的监听端口:在数据库的配置文件中,可以找到一个参数用于配置监听端口。通过修改该参数的值,可以将数据库服务的监听端口修改为指定的端口号。

    4. 配置网络防火墙:如果计算机或服务器上启用了防火墙,需要配置防火墙以允许指定端口的访问。可以通过在防火墙设置中添加入站规则来实现。

    5. 测试数据库连接:在完成上述配置后,可以通过使用客户端工具(如MySQL Workbench)或编程语言(如Java、Python)来测试数据库连接。在连接数据库时,需要指定数据库所在计算机的IP地址和映射的端口号。

    总结:
    数据库映射端口是用于将数据库服务暴露给外部应用程序或网络的端口号。通过配置数据库的监听端口和网络防火墙,可以实现远程访问数据库。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部